Committee to Advance Identity Standards for Cloud Computing

The international consortium, OASIS, has formed a new group to address the serious security challenges posed by identity management in cloud computing. The new OASIS Identity in the Cloud (IDCloud) Technical Committee will identify gaps in existing identity management standards and investigate the need for profiles to achieve interoperability within current standards.

Fedora 13 Propels Open Source Innovation, Virtualization Enhancements

RALEIGH, N.C.: The Fedora Project, a Red Hat, Inc. sponsored and community-supported open source collaboration, today announced the availability of Fedora 13, the latest version of its free open source operating system distribution. Fedora 13 combines some of the latest open source features with an open and transparent development process.
